Thick stool smear wet mount examination: a new approach in stool microscopy

Summary
A new thick stool smear wet mount method significantly improves the detection of intestinal parasites compared to the conventional direct wet mount. This novel diagnostic approach offers superior sensitivity for identifying parasitic infections in stool samples.
Area of Science:
- Medical laboratory diagnostics
- Parasitology
- Microscopy techniques
Background:
- Microscopic stool examination is the standard for diagnosing intestinal parasitic infections.
- Conventional methods like direct wet mount have limitations in sensitivity.
Purpose of the Study:
- To introduce and evaluate a novel thick stool smear wet mount method for diagnosing intestinal parasitic infections.
- To compare the diagnostic efficacy of the new method against the conventional direct wet mount.
Main Methods:
- A new thick stool smear wet mount technique was developed.
- Eighty stool samples were analyzed using both the novel method and the conventional lacto-phenol cotton blue direct wet mount method.
- Statistical analysis was performed using McNemar's test.
Main Results:
- The novel thick stool smear wet mount method identified parasites in 31 out of 80 samples (38.75%).
- The conventional method identified parasites in 16 out of 80 samples (20%).
- The difference in detection rates was statistically significant (P < 0.04).
Conclusions:
- The thick stool smear wet mount method demonstrates superior sensitivity in detecting intestinal parasites compared to the direct wet mount.
- This novel method holds promise for enhancing the laboratory diagnosis of parasitic infections.
